Nestled on the outskirts of the Montrose district east of the city center is the Booker-Lowe Gallery, a novel gem of a gallery that focuses on Australian aboriginal art. Beautiful paintings, thought-provoking sculptures, and exotic artworks that reflect the unique culture of Australia are on display. Exhibits include exceptional bark paintings, ceremonial objects, canvasses, sculptures, and much more. The gallery has a homely vibe and the art is well-curated and lends an in-depth insight into this little-known culture. The gallery definitely is a must visit when in the city.

Alabama Song is an art gallery that experiments with fine art work. Additionally, the gallery also hosts events for community, like poetry reading, song release and different art shows happen here. The center has art workshops and also serves as a platform to explore artistry.
A melting pot of culture in the city of Houston, Asian/Pacific American Heritage Association celebrates Asian tradition. Since its inception, the center has been the bridge between American and Asian cultures, and has featured multiple entertainment and educational programs. Through festivals, stage shows, concerts and theater, the center aims to get the community involved with those of different cultural and racial backgrounds.
A popular art space in Houston, PEVETO immerses you into the world of art. This sizable art gallery specializes in modern art and is home to a vast collection of paintings, sculpture and other intriguing installations, by some of the city's most renowned artists. The gallery also provides a platform for young artists, with a portion dedicated to exhibiting the work of budding local artists. Regular, temporary exhibits are also organised on site, wherein various topics are discussed and displayed through fascinating, artistic installations.
